Regarding SMART data, run CrystalDiskInfo. I mentioned this in my earlier posts - this is just to rule out the hard drive.
http://crystalmark.info/software/CrystalDiskInfo/index-e.html

See if you have anything under the Raw Values column for
05 - Reallocated Sectors
07 - Seek Error Rate
and C4 through C8.

I'm pretty sure you won't find anything, but this is just to rule it out.

Thought I'd reword this. Considering you've been crashing with both sticks in, and each stick individually, I am hesistant to still point to the RAM. Normally this would have me thinking you need to bump vNB or VTT (called system agent voltage on MSI boards), but I dunno how important that is on the p67. The other thing is we have already considerably relaxed the timings from cas 6 to cas 9. I suppose we could still try 1.55vDIMM, but it seems somewhat moot considering the relaxed timings.

Are you still overclocking your CPU currently?

Hey select, it might be your recently installed program or windows update.

Try to system restore it to like 2 months back or as far back as it will let you. Don't install any windows update or any programs after restoring the system - just starcraft 2. Then play like you normally do. If everything works, its probably a program that's causing the problem.

To system restore on windows 7: Right click on My Computer->Properties->System Protection->System Restore

Hope this helps.
